Marking-scheme solution
• (i) Division of work
The principle of Division of work suggests that work can be
performed more efficiently if it is divided into specialised tasks.
The intent of division of work is to produce more and better
• work for the same effort.
A trained specialist who is competent, is required to perform
each job leading to specialization which results in efficient and
effective output.
• (ii) Authority and Responsibility
The principle of Authority and Responsibility suggests that
managers require authority commensurate with their
• responsibility.
An organisation should build safeguards against abuse of
managerial power. At the same time, a manager should have
necessary authority to carry out his responsibility.
• (iii) Discipline
It is the obedience to organizational rules and employment
agreement which are necessary for the working of the
• organization.
It requires good superiors at all levels, clear and fair agreement
and judicious application of penalties.

Significance of principles of management:
• (i) Scientific decisions:
Principles of management help in taking scientific decisions
because the decisions based on principles are free from bias and
prejudice and emphasise logic rather than blind faith.
• $\displaystyle 25$
Scientific decisions based on principles are timely, realistic and
subject to measurement and evaluation. They are based on the
objective assessment of the situation.
• (ii) Providing managers with insights into reality:
Principles of management provide useful insights into reality by
enabling the managers to learn from past mistakes and conserve time
• by solving recurring problems quickly.
Adherence to these principles adds to their knowledge, ability
and understanding of managerial
situations and circumstances
thereby increasing managerial efficiency.
• (iii) Meeting changing environment requirements: :
Principles of management help the managers in meeting
changing environment requirements because they can be
modified according to the changes taking place in the
• environment.
As management principles are flexible, they are able to adapt to
